Manchester United have no plans to move for Chelsea left-back

Last summer it was Mason Mount, but now talks are underway to potentially take Raheem Sterling from Stamford Bridge. One player likely to be offered to the Reds doesn’t have many admirers at Old Trafford.

According to the Manchester Evening News, United have no desire to launch a bid for Ben Chilwell, who is also being frozen out of first-team plans at Chelsea.

United have both senior left-backs – Luke Shaw and Tyrell Malacia – injured which means Diogo Dalot, a right-back, is having to cover on the opposite flank.

The biggest problem with Chilwell is his worrying injury record. I don’t think United are going to fall for such a trap. They would be stupid to move for such an injury-prone player to replace injury-prone players.

Shaw is due back next month but less is known about Malacia’s injury.

United youngster Harry Amass impressed at left-back during the pre-season tour of the United States.
